La evolución de las bases de datos ha revolucionado la forma en que almacenamos y accedemos a la información. Desde los sistemas jerárquicos de la década de 1950 hasta las innovadoras soluciones modernas de bases de datos NoSQL, esta línea de tiempo destaca los avances clave en el desarrollo de las bases de datos a lo largo de las décadas, proporcionando un contexto histórico que resalta su importancia en el panorama tecnológico actual.
Índice de contenido
- 1 1950s: Los inicios – Sistemas jerárquicos y de red
- 2 1960s: El inicio del SGBD
- 3 1970: La revolución del modelo relacional
- 4 1980: La llegada de Oracle y SQL Server
- 5 1990: La era de los objetos
- 6 2000: Bases de datos distribuidas
- 7 2010: La popularidad de NoSQL
- 8 2020: Avances tecnológicos – Inteligencia artificial y machine learning
- 9 2022: El papel de la nube en el almacenamiento de datos
- 10 Tendencias actuales: Integración de tecnologías emergentes
- 11 Conclusiones: ¿Hacia dónde se dirigen las bases de datos en el futuro?
1950s: Los inicios – Sistemas jerárquicos y de red
Los primeros ejemplos de bases de datos se desarrollaron en la década de 1950, marcando el comienzo de la evolución de las bases de datos. Los sistemas jerárquicos, como el Information Management System (IMS) de IBM, ofrecían un modelo de almacenamiento de información en forma de árbol. Estos sistemas fueron complejos y limitados para el manejo de relaciones múltiples, lo que llevó a la creación de sistemas de red que permitían mayores interacciones y flexibilidad. Sin embargo, todavía carecían de un verdadero modelo que pudiera adaptarse a las necesidades cambiantes de la información.
1960s: El inicio del SGBD
En esta década, se comenzaron a forjar soluciones más sofisticadas con la aparición de los primeros sistemas de gestión de bases de datos (SGBD). Estas soluciones buscaban facilitar el acceso a los datos, proporcionando una estructura coherente para el almacenamiento y recuperación. Las empresas comenzaron a reconocer la importancia de un manejo más eficiente de la información, lo que resultó en un aumento significativo en la adopción de estas tecnologías.
1970: La revolución del modelo relacional
El mayor hito en la evolución de las bases de datos llegó en 1970, cuando Edgar Codd, un investigador de IBM, propuso el modelo relacional. Este nuevo enfoque revolucionó la forma en que se podía gestionar la información al permitir que los datos fueran almacenados en tablas relacionadas. Al introducir el concepto de SQL (Structured Query Language), Codd sentó las bases para los sistemas de bases de datos que aún usamos hoy en día. Esta innovación permitió a los usuarios interactuar de manera más sencilla y efectiva con los datos, impulsando la adopción generalizada del modelo relacional en el mercado.
1980: La llegada de Oracle y SQL Server
Con la aceptación general del modelo relacional en los 80, comenzó una explosión en la aparición de SGBD relacionales. Empresas como Oracle y Microsoft lanzaron productos innovadores que se convirtieron en líderes en el mercado. Oracle, presentada en 1979, fue una de las primeras empresas en comercializar un SGBD que utilizaba SQL. SQL Server de Microsoft, lanzado en 1989, trajo consigo una creciente popularidad y adoptó un enfoque más centrado en las soluciones empresariales. Estos SGBD comenzaron a establecerse como estándares de facto para organizaciones que buscaban robustez y escalabilidad en la administración de datos.
1990: La era de los objetos
Durante la década de 1990, la evolución de las bases de datos continuó con la introducción de los SGBD orientados a objetos. Este tipo de bases de datos permitía que los datos se representaran como «objetos», integrando tanto la información como el comportamiento en un único modelo. Esto fue particularmente útil para aplicaciones que necesitaban almacenar estructuras complejas. Aunque no reemplazaron a los SGBD relacionales, ofrecieron una alternativa al proporcionar flexibilidad en el manejo de datos más complejos, y su utilización se expandió en áreas como la multimedia y la ingeniería.
2000: Bases de datos distribuidas
La explosión de datos producida por Internet en la década de 2000 llevó al desarrollo de bases de datos distribuidas. Estas soluciones permitieron que la información se almacenara en múltiples ubicaciones, facilitando así su acceso y gestión a nivel global. Esta capacidad se volvió vital para las empresas que necesitaban manejar grandes volúmenes de datos de usuarios y sistemas múltiples. Con la creciente necesidad de alta disponibilidad y recuperación ante desastres, las bases de datos distribuidas cambiaron la forma en que las organizaciones abordaban el almacenamiento y la gestión de datos.
2010: La popularidad de NoSQL
La primera parte de la década de 2010 trajo consigo la popularidad de las bases de datos NoSQL, que ofrecían nuevas alternativas de almacenamiento y acceso a datos. Diseñadas para manejar grandes volúmenes de información y permitir una mayor flexibilidad, las bases de datos NoSQL se convirtieron en una opción atractiva para empresas tecnológicas. Su estructura no tabular permitía modelos de datos más escalables y adaptables, siendo ideales para aplicaciones que requerían velocidad y eficiencia como las redes sociales y la analítica de datos.
2020: Avances tecnológicos – Inteligencia artificial y machine learning
En la última década, hemos sido testigos de enormes avances tecnológicos en el ámbito de las bases de datos, con la integración de inteligencia artificial y machine learning. Estas tecnologías han cambiado radicalmente la forma en que se manejan y analizan los datos. La capacidad de predecir patrones en grandes conjuntos de datos ha permitido a las organizaciones no solo optimizar procesos, sino también tomar decisiones basadas en análisis predictivos. Esto se ha convertido en un estándar en industrias que requieren una comprensión profunda de sus datos para mejorar la experiencia del cliente y la eficiencia operativa.
2022: El papel de la nube en el almacenamiento de datos
La llegada y evolución de la nube han transformado aún más la forma en que las organizaciones almacenan y gestionan sus datos. Las soluciones de bases de datos en la nube ofrecen flexibilidad, escalabilidad y reducción de costos operativos. Sin embargo, también presentan desafíos, como la seguridad de los datos y la necesidad de cumplir con regulaciones específicas. A medida que las empresas adoptan la nube, el enfoque en la infraestructura cloud y el mantenimiento de la integridad de los datos se vuelven cada vez más críticos.
Tendencias actuales: Integración de tecnologías emergentes
La combinación de IoT, inteligencia artificial y análisis avanzado de datos está permitiendo soluciones más sofisticadas que pueden manejar volúmenes de datos masivos. Las empresas se esfuerzan por superar la brecha entre almacenamiento y análisis, utilizando tecnologías que favorecen la automatización y la optimización de decisiones en tiempo real. Esto marca el comienzo de una nueva era en la evolución de las bases de datos.
Conclusiones: ¿Hacia dónde se dirigen las bases de datos en el futuro?
Con todos estos avances en bases de datos, es evidente que la industria está en constante evolución. La combinación de nuevas tecnologías y metodologías va a seguir transformando el modo en que las empresas manejan la información. Las bases de datos del futuro estarán cada vez más centradas en la automatización, la inteligencia artificial y la adaptabilidad en la nube. A medida que surgen nuevas necesidades de datos, la forma en que se diseñen y manejen las bases de datos deberá evolucionar para seguir siendo relevantes en un entorno de datos en rápida expansión.
La evolución de las bases de datos es un campo interesante que refleja los cambios en la tecnología y las demandas comerciales. Las innovaciones en este espacio han permitido que las organizaciones gestionen datos de manera más eficiente y efectiva, marcando una diferencia significativa en la forma en que interactuamos con la información en la actualidad y en el futuro.









